Dong Hoi: ratio of agricultural production decreases by 6.5% of total value of the economy
(Quang Binh Website) - Over the past three years, Dong Hoi city's economic structure shifted onto right orientation, increasing ratio of industry - handicraft and service production and decreasing ratio of agricultural production. Until now, the ratio of agricultural production decreases by 6.5% of total value of the economy.
Top priority is given to the development of industry - handicraft and service, aiming at attract laborers from rural and agricultural areas. At present, 1,850 industry-handicraft production establishments are registered in the city, attracting 9,850 regular laborers with the production value of reaching VND935 billion.
In 2009-2010 period, Dong Hoi city continues to decrease ratio of agricultural production with the rate of about 5.5%, increasing ratio of industry-handicraft production by 44% and service by 55.5%.
